Dietary fiber, a crucial component of a healthy eating plan, presents a challenge for individuals adhering to a ketogenic diet. This nutritional framework emphasizes high fat intake while significantly restricting carbohydrates. Consequently, many traditional high-fiber sources, such as grains, beans, and most fruits, are excluded due to their carbohydrate content. Meeting the recommended daily fiber intake requires careful food selection and strategic planning when following a ketogenic approach. A common challenge is constipation, often experienced when transitioning into keto, because the usual sources of fiber are restricted. The best approach requires researching low-carb options for fiber.
Adequate fiber intake is vital for promoting digestive health, regulating blood sugar levels, and supporting overall well-being. Fiber contributes to satiety, aiding in weight management, and plays a role in maintaining a healthy gut microbiome. 1. Non-starchy vegetables
Non-starchy vegetables constitute a cornerstone of fiber acquisition within a ketogenic dietary framework. Their relatively low carbohydrate content allows for greater consumption volumes compared to other fiber sources, thereby enabling individuals to achieve adequate daily intake while maintaining ketosis.
-
Fiber Content Variation
Fiber concentrations differ among non-starchy vegetables. Leafy greens, such as spinach and kale, offer moderate amounts of fiber, while cruciferous vegetables, including broccoli and cauliflower, typically exhibit higher levels. Selecting a variety of non-starchy vegetables optimizes fiber intake and diversifies nutrient consumption. For example, one cup of raw spinach contains about 1 gram of fiber, whereas one cup of raw broccoli provides roughly 2.4 grams.
-
Digestive Impact
The fiber present in non-starchy vegetables aids in promoting healthy bowel function. Insoluble fiber, prevalent in many of these vegetables, adds bulk to the stool, facilitating regular elimination and mitigating constipation. Soluble fiber contributes to a feeling of fullness and may help regulate blood sugar levels, further supporting metabolic control on a ketogenic diet.
-
Preparation Methods
Preparation techniques can influence both the fiber content and digestibility of non-starchy vegetables. Steaming or lightly sauting vegetables preserves fiber integrity better than boiling, which can leach nutrients into the water. Raw consumption of certain vegetables, such as salads, maximizes fiber intake but may not be suitable for all individuals due to digestive sensitivities.
-
Synergistic Effects
Combining non-starchy vegetables with healthy fats, a hallmark of the ketogenic diet, enhances nutrient absorption. The presence of dietary fats aids in the uptake of fat-soluble vitamins found in these vegetables, further optimizing nutritional benefits. For instance, adding olive oil to a salad containing leafy greens improves the absorption of vitamins A, E, and K.

2. Low-carb seeds
Low-carbohydrate seeds represent a valuable avenue for increasing dietary fiber intake within the constraints of a ketogenic diet. Their favorable macronutrient profile, characterized by high fat content and minimal net carbohydrates, renders them a compatible and efficient source of fiber for individuals seeking to adhere to ketogenic principles while addressing potential fiber deficiencies.
-
Fiber Density and Types
Certain low-carbohydrate seeds, such as chia seeds and flax seeds, possess a high fiber density relative to their serving size. This characteristic enables significant fiber intake without a substantial increase in carbohydrate consumption. Furthermore, these seeds contain both soluble and insoluble fiber, contributing to a balanced impact on digestive health. Chia seeds, for example, swell in the digestive tract, promoting satiety and regular bowel movements. Flax seeds offer lignans in addition to fiber, providing potential antioxidant benefits.
-
Incorporation Methods
The versatility of low-carbohydrate seeds facilitates their seamless integration into various ketogenic recipes and meal plans. They can be added to smoothies, sprinkled on salads, or incorporated into low-carbohydrate baked goods. Ground flax seeds, in particular, serve as a binding agent in recipes, contributing to texture and structure while simultaneously increasing fiber content. Whole chia seeds can be soaked in liquid to create a pudding-like consistency, providing a convenient and fiber-rich snack.
-
Impact on Satiety and Blood Sugar Regulation
The high fiber content of these seeds contributes to increased satiety, potentially aiding in weight management efforts. Soluble fiber slows gastric emptying, promoting a feeling of fullness and reducing overall caloric intake. Furthermore, the consumption of low-carbohydrate seeds may help regulate blood sugar levels by slowing the absorption of glucose into the bloodstream, which can be particularly beneficial for individuals with insulin resistance or type 2 diabetes.
-
Considerations for Consumption
While generally well-tolerated, excessive consumption of low-carbohydrate seeds may lead to digestive discomfort in some individuals. Starting with small servings and gradually increasing intake can help mitigate potential gastrointestinal side effects. Additionally, it is advisable to consume these seeds with adequate water to prevent constipation and facilitate optimal digestion. Individuals with pre-existing digestive conditions should consult with a healthcare professional before significantly increasing their intake of low-carbohydrate seeds.

3. Limited Berries
Berries, while generally higher in carbohydrates than leafy greens or seeds, offer a potential source of fiber on a ketogenic diet. The concept of “limited berries” acknowledges both their nutritional benefits and the necessity for careful portion control to maintain ketosis.
-
Fiber Contribution and Carbohydrate Impact
Berries, specifically raspberries, blackberries, and strawberries, contain notable quantities of fiber relative to their carbohydrate content. This fiber can contribute towards daily requirements without drastically elevating blood glucose levels, provided consumption remains moderate. For instance, a half-cup serving of raspberries provides approximately 4 grams of fiber and 7 grams of net carbohydrates. Consistent monitoring of carbohydrate intake is crucial to prevent exceeding daily limits and disrupting ketosis.
-
Antioxidant Benefits and Micronutrient Density
Beyond fiber, berries are rich sources of antioxidants and essential micronutrients, including vitamin C and various phytonutrients. These compounds contribute to overall health and well-being, supporting immune function and mitigating oxidative stress. The inclusion of berries, even in limited quantities, enhances the nutritional profile of a ketogenic diet beyond its macronutrient focus.
-
Glycemic Response and Portion Control Strategies
The glycemic index (GI) and glycemic load (GL) of berries are relatively low compared to other fruits, indicating a slower and more controlled impact on blood sugar levels. However, individual responses can vary. Implementing portion control strategies, such as pre-measuring servings and pairing berries with healthy fats (e.g., coconut cream, nuts), can further minimize glycemic effects. Regular blood glucose monitoring helps assess individual tolerance levels and inform dietary adjustments.
-
Varietal Selection and Net Carbohydrate Awareness
The net carbohydrate content varies among different types of berries. Raspberries and blackberries typically contain fewer net carbohydrates per serving compared to blueberries or strawberries. Prioritizing lower-carbohydrate varieties allows for larger serving sizes while remaining within ketogenic parameters. Careful examination of nutritional labels and accurate measurement of portions are essential for informed decision-making.

4. Psyllium husk
Psyllium husk, derived from the seeds of Plantago ovata, serves as a concentrated source of soluble fiber. Its utility within ketogenic diets stems from its minimal net carbohydrate contribution coupled with its substantial fiber content, addressing a common nutritional challenge in carbohydrate-restricted eating patterns.
-
Exceptional Fiber Density
Psyllium husk exhibits a high fiber-to-volume ratio. A single tablespoon typically contains several grams of fiber while contributing negligible net carbohydrates. This density allows for significant fiber intake without substantially impacting the ketogenic macronutrient balance. For example, one tablespoon (approximately 9 grams) of psyllium husk can provide around 7 grams of fiber. This makes it an efficient supplement for individuals struggling to meet fiber goals through whole foods alone.
-
Mechanism of Action in the Digestive Tract
As a soluble fiber, psyllium husk absorbs water in the digestive tract, forming a viscous gel. This gel-like consistency promotes satiety, regulates bowel movements, and can aid in controlling blood sugar levels. The gel-forming properties add bulk to the stool, which is particularly beneficial in mitigating constipation, a frequent complaint during the initial adaptation phase of a ketogenic diet. Furthermore, this process may also contribute to lowering cholesterol levels.
-
Applications in Ketogenic Cooking
Psyllium husk finds practical application in ketogenic baking and cooking as a binding agent and texture enhancer. Its ability to absorb water creates a more bread-like consistency in low-carbohydrate baked goods, compensating for the absence of gluten. This can improve the palatability and overall success of ketogenic recipes. For example, it can be used in making keto-friendly bread, pizza crusts, or muffins.
-
Considerations for Consumption and Hydration
Due to its water-absorbing properties, adequate hydration is crucial when consuming psyllium husk. Insufficient fluid intake can exacerbate constipation or lead to intestinal discomfort. It is generally recommended to consume psyllium husk with at least 8 ounces of water. Individuals with pre-existing gastrointestinal conditions should consult a healthcare professional before incorporating psyllium husk into their diet. Rapidly increasing psyllium husk intake can cause bloating and gas. Therefore, gradual introduction is advised.

5. Coconut flour
Coconut flour, derived from dried coconut meat, presents a significant avenue for augmenting dietary fiber intake within the constraints of a ketogenic diet. Its unique composition, characterized by a high fiber content and low net carbohydrate profile, renders it a pertinent ingredient for individuals seeking to balance macronutrient ratios and digestive well-being.
-
Fiber Composition and Impact on Ketosis
Coconut flour possesses an exceptionally high fiber concentration. The majority of its carbohydrate content is comprised of fiber, resulting in a minimal net carbohydrate impact on blood glucose levels. This allows for increased consumption volumes without disrupting ketosis. For example, a quarter-cup serving of coconut flour contains approximately 10 grams of fiber and only 2 grams of net carbohydrates, making it an efficient choice for those seeking to increase their fiber intake without compromising ketogenic principles.
-
Water Absorption and Baking Applications
Coconut flour exhibits a high water absorption capacity, necessitating careful adjustments in recipe formulations. This characteristic can contribute to the texture and structure of ketogenic baked goods, mitigating the dryness often associated with low-carbohydrate baking. When used effectively, coconut flour improves the palatability and overall success of ketogenic recipes, promoting adherence to the diet. It can be used in recipes for keto breads, muffins, and pancakes.
-
Nutrient Profile and Dietary Considerations
Beyond its fiber content, coconut flour provides a source of medium-chain triglycerides (MCTs), which are readily utilized by the body for energy. It also contains essential minerals such as iron and potassium. However, its high fiber content may require gradual introduction into the diet to prevent digestive discomfort. Individuals with digestive sensitivities should monitor their response and adjust intake accordingly. The flour also lacks gluten which makes it safe for celiac people or those on gluten-free diet.
-
Substitution Strategies and Usage Guidelines
Coconut flour cannot be directly substituted for wheat flour in traditional recipes due to its distinct properties. A smaller quantity is typically required, and additional liquid is often necessary to compensate for its high absorption capacity. Experimentation and adherence to established ketogenic recipes are crucial for optimal results. Combining it with other low carb flours like almond flour is an option. Recipes may also call for more eggs than traditional recipes.

6. Avocado
Avocado presents a significant dietary element for individuals seeking to increase fiber intake while adhering to a ketogenic diet. Its unique nutritional profile, characterized by a substantial fat content and a moderate fiber contribution, aligns well with the macronutrient requirements of ketogenic eating patterns, providing a practical and palatable means to address potential fiber deficiencies.
-
Fiber Content and Net Carbohydrate Ratio
Avocado possesses a notable fiber content relative to its net carbohydrate count. A single avocado can provide a significant portion of the recommended daily fiber intake while contributing a relatively low amount of net carbohydrates. This balance renders it a suitable fiber source for those restricting carbohydrate consumption to maintain ketosis. A medium-sized avocado, for example, contains approximately 12 grams of fiber and around 3-4 grams of net carbs (total carbs minus fiber). This composition allows for meaningful fiber intake without jeopardizing the state of ketosis.
-
Fat Profile and Satiety
The high fat content of avocado contributes to increased satiety, which can be particularly beneficial within a ketogenic diet focused on fat consumption. This satiety-promoting effect aids in controlling appetite and reducing overall caloric intake. The fats in avocado are primarily monounsaturated, which are associated with heart health benefits. The combination of fiber and healthy fats contribute to a feeling of fullness that can help in managing weight and reducing hunger cravings.
-
Versatility in Ketogenic Meal Planning
Avocado offers diverse applications within ketogenic meal planning. It can be consumed directly, incorporated into salads, blended into smoothies, or utilized as a spread. Its mild flavor profile allows it to complement a wide array of ketogenic-friendly ingredients. Its texture and creaminess make it a good addition to recipes that lack moisture or require richness. Common applications include using it as a base for dips, adding it to salads for healthy fats and fiber, or using it as a topping for meat or fish dishes.
-
Micronutrient Contribution
In addition to fiber and healthy fats, avocado provides a range of essential micronutrients, including potassium, magnesium, and various vitamins. These nutrients contribute to overall health and well-being, complementing the macronutrient focus of a ketogenic diet. Including avocado in a ketogenic diet can help ensure that important vitamins and minerals are consumed.

Question 1: Is fiber truly necessary on a ketogenic diet?
While the primary focus of a ketogenic diet centers on macronutrient ratios, fiber remains an essential component for optimal health. Adequate fiber intake supports digestive regularity, promotes satiety, and contributes to overall well-being. Neglecting fiber can lead to constipation and other gastrointestinal disturbances.
Question 2: What are the best sources of fiber on a ketogenic diet?
Suitable fiber sources include non-starchy vegetables (e.g., spinach, broccoli), low-carbohydrate seeds (e.g., chia, flax), limited quantities of berries (e.g., raspberries, blackberries), psyllium husk, coconut flour, and avocado. Strategic incorporation of these elements into meal plans is crucial.
Question 3: How much fiber is recommended on a ketogenic diet?
While individual needs vary, aiming for the general recommendation of 25-30 grams of fiber per day remains prudent, even within a ketogenic context. Careful monitoring of carbohydrate intake is essential to maintain ketosis while pursuing this target. Adjustments may be necessary based on individual tolerance and metabolic response.
Question 4: Can fiber supplements be used on a ketogenic diet?
Fiber supplements, such as psyllium husk or methylcellulose, can be utilized to augment fiber intake, provided they are low in net carbohydrates. It is important to select supplements without added sugars or unnecessary ingredients. Adequate hydration is imperative when consuming fiber supplements to prevent constipation.
Question 5: How does fiber impact ketosis?
Fiber itself does not directly impact ketosis, as it is largely indigestible and contributes minimally to blood glucose levels. However, the carbohydrate content of fiber-rich foods must be carefully considered to ensure that overall carbohydrate intake remains within ketogenic limits.
Question 6: What are the potential side effects of increasing fiber intake on a ketogenic diet?
Rapidly increasing fiber intake can lead to gastrointestinal discomfort, including bloating, gas, and constipation. Gradual introduction of fiber-rich foods and adequate hydration can mitigate these effects. Consulting a healthcare professional or registered dietitian is advisable for individuals with pre-existing digestive conditions.

Tip 1: Prioritize Non-Starchy Vegetables with Every Meal. Integrate leafy greens, cruciferous vegetables, and other low-carbohydrate vegetables into each meal to augment fiber intake. Examples include incorporating spinach into omelets, adding broccoli to stir-fries, or consuming a side salad with lunch and dinner. The consistent inclusion of these vegetables throughout the day significantly contributes to overall fiber consumption.
Tip 2: Incorporate Low-Carbohydrate Seeds Daily. Add chia seeds, flax seeds, or hemp seeds to smoothies, yogurt, or salads. These seeds provide a concentrated source of fiber and essential nutrients. For example, adding one tablespoon of chia seeds to a morning smoothie increases fiber intake by approximately 5 grams.
Tip 3: Monitor and Strategically Include Berries. Limit berry consumption to small portions and prioritize lower-carbohydrate varieties like raspberries and blackberries. A half-cup serving of raspberries provides a moderate amount of fiber without significantly impacting blood glucose levels. Track the carbohydrate content of berries to maintain ketosis.
Tip 4: Utilize Psyllium Husk as a Fiber Supplement. Incorporate psyllium husk into daily routines as a fiber supplement. Mixing one teaspoon of psyllium husk with water or a low-carbohydrate beverage can increase fiber intake without adding significant carbohydrates. Ensure adequate hydration when consuming psyllium husk to prevent constipation.
Tip 5: Experiment with Coconut Flour in Baking. Replace a portion of almond flour with coconut flour in ketogenic baking recipes. Coconut flour provides a higher fiber content compared to almond flour, contributing to a more balanced macronutrient profile. Remember that coconut flour absorbs more liquid, requiring recipe adjustments.
Tip 6: Make Avocado a Regular Dietary Component. Consume avocado regularly as a source of healthy fats and fiber. Avocado can be added to salads, used as a spread, or incorporated into smoothies. A single avocado provides a significant amount of fiber and monounsaturated fats.
Tip 7: Track Fiber Intake. Monitor daily fiber intake to ensure adequate consumption. Utilize food tracking apps or spreadsheets to record the fiber content of consumed foods. This awareness facilitates informed dietary choices and adjustments.
